TUFLOW Message
ERROR 0120 - Could not find ",a," in database ",a,

Alternate Message
NA

Message Type
ERROR

Description
The boundary condition ID in GIS 2d_bc file could not be found in the boundary condition database csv file.

Suggestions
Check the names in the 2d_bc file and the bc_dbase.csv are consistent.
This error is common if a user has mistakenly used either a 2d_bc template file in combination with the command "Read GIS SA =="; or the 2d_sa template file in combination with the Read GIS BC == command. Check that the correct template file is matched with the correct command. 2d_sa should be used with Read GIS SA == , 2d_bc should be used with Read GIS BC == .
